The menu here is a delightful exploration of classic Italian flavors. From the crispy, thin-crust pizzas to the perfectly made pastas, every dish is crafted with attention to detail and a deep respect for Italian culinary traditions. The pizza is, of course, the star of the show. The Margherita, with its rich tomato sauce, fresh mozzarella, and basil, is a favorite among regulars. It's simple yet bursting with flavor, showcasing the quality of ingredients that Al Fagianetto takes pride in. The crust has just the right amount of crunch, making every bite a pure joy.

If you're in the mood for something a bit more adventurous, try the Diavola pizza, topped with spicy salami, which strikes the perfect balance between heat and flavor. The menu also offers an array of delicious pasta options, like the classic Spaghetti alla Carbonara or the rich Lasagna. Good Italian food very close to the train station, perfect for a quick lunch while traveling. The best waiter we've ever encountered in Italy. We were there on Friday, September 12th, around 3 p.m. Unfortunately, we don't remember his name, but we send our warmest regards :) The only place in Italy where we got a free appetizer. I highly recommend this place :)

This restaurant was conveniently located by our hotel. My wife had the lasagna Bolognese and I had Cacio E Pepe and both dishes were very good. We ordered a house bottle of red wine and it was decent especially for $10 euro.

Great location, good price for being close to the train station. The pizzas bas was a bit thicker than a normal Italian one, lots of olive oil on top, but in a good way. The salmon pasta was also okay for me as a non-western tourist, my companion does not like it.
